What are the responsibilities and job description for the Director of Programs position at Urbana Youth Center?
As an ideal candidate, you have proven program experience in a highly dynamic setting. Your organizational, communication, and leadership skills are second to none and you enjoy developing engaging, educational programs that develop strong young people.
Objectives of this Role
· At all times, make sure the organization fosters open hearts, open minds, and open doors.
· Ensure the youth center’s lineup of programs delivers student success and develop new programs to meet the ever-evolving needs of students.
· Build and maintain essential relationships throughout the community to fully realize UYC’s goals.
· Effectively lead the behavior program and ensure students understand and follow the rules.
· Collaborate with executive-level management in the development of goals and long-term plans to maximize growth.
Daily, Weekly, and Monthly Responsibilities
· Developing, implementing, and monitoring UYC Programs based on success, interest, and availability in consultation with executive team.
o This includes collaboration with community organizations, individuals, and local schools to develop programs of interest.
o Scheduling and coordinating the lineup of programs to ensure year-round access to a robust offering of diverse programs.
· Oversee and support the supervisor of the Homework & Study Assistance (HSA) Program and the High School Equivalency Program (HSEP).
o Work with the supervisor to assist with student success.
o Lead the UYC study group effort through the HSA program.
o Identify students eligible for the HSEP and take all necessary steps to enroll them.
· Supervising, setting goals with and for, and reviewing the performance of any subordinates or volunteers as necessary.
· Consulting on grants and, in some cases, researching, writing, applying for, and executing grants.
· Cultivating collaborative relationships to further develop the reach and impact of the Youth Center’s programs in the community.
· Lead and carry out the behavior program in accordance with the Policy and Procedure Handbook (PPH).
· Work closely with the executive team to uphold integrity and establish and maintain a trusting, inclusive, and productive environment.
· Any and all other tasks the executive director may request.
